New semester, new happiness: Fresher semester highlights in Stuttgart!

The University of Stuttgart warmly welcomes its new students. A variety of offers and support measures are available to support first-year students as they start their studies. The introductory week is scheduled for the period from October 6th to 12th, 2025, with the highlight being the first semester welcome “Avete Academici” on Monday, October 6th. In addition to the welcome, a comprehensive orientation program for international students and the buddy program “ready.study.stuttgart” are offered to make the start easier for new students. The university emphasizes the desire for a positive start to studies and offers video instructions on digital services that are accessible to everyone.

The official start of lectures for the winter semester is on Monday, October 13, 2025. It is advisable to check the introductory dates regularly, as they are continually updated. The student representative stuvus is also available to offer support and answer questions from new members. These measures are intended to help new students find their way quickly and easily in their new environment.

Introductory events for study orientation

At the Friedrich-Alexander University Erlangen-Nuremberg (FAU), the introductory events for new students begin at the end of September, even if the official semester times stipulate a start in October. The start of lectures in the winter semester 2025/26 also falls on Monday, October 13, 2025.

As part of the introductory events, there will be an introductory day “Welcome on board!” offered online for first-year students on October 6th. Further repeat dates are planned for October 10th and 31st, 2025. The Central Student Advisory Service also offers online information events that provide important information for starting your studies.

Participation in these events is recommended, even if it is not mandatory. Students should also familiarize themselves with their subject examination regulations and their module schedules. If you have organizational questions, new students can contact the ZSB for assistance.

Study start aid for financial support

Many first-year students could also benefit from the study start aid, which is offered to new students under the age of 25 from communities of need or with comparable social benefits. This assistance applies to initial enrollments at universities and enables students to reduce financial burdens.

Students who take part in preliminary courses should apply for study start aid directly at the start of the course. The authorizations are tied to certain social benefits, such as citizen's benefit or social assistance.

Applications for study start aid will be submitted electronically via BAföG Digital from September 2, 2024, and the deadlines are clearly defined. The one-off grant is 1,000 euros and is intended in particular for study-related expenses, such as IT equipment or teaching materials. It is also advisable to submit a BAföG application, as many people who are eligible may also be eligible for BAföG, which means additional financial support.
